Since mid-2001, several mobile operators have introduced a so-called "internetworking charge". So any connection will be charged to the sender. Here we will print out the list of all the operators and their costs.

This operators charge internetworking:

  • Austria: Mobilkom A1 (US$ 0.080)

  • Austria: T-Mobile A1 (US$ 0.080)

  • Belgium: Base (US$ 0.030 )

  • Belgium: Mobistar (US$ 0.080 )

  • Belgium: Proximus (US$ 0.080 )

  • France: Bouygues (US$ 0.080)

  • France: SFR (US$ 0.080)

  • France: FTMI Orange (US$ 0.080)

  • Germany: E-Plus (US$ 0.080)

  • Germany: Viag Interkom (US$ 0.080)

  • Germany: Quam (US$ 0.080)

  • Germany: D1 T-Mobil (US$ 0.080)

  • Germany: D2 Vodafone (US$ 0.080)

  • Italy: Vodafone Omnitel (US$ 0.030)

  • Italy: Tim (US$ 0.030 )

  • Italy: Wind (US$ 0.030 )

  • Italy: TRE-H3G (US$ 0.060)

  • Netherlands: Vodafone/Libertel (US$ 0.080)

  • Netherlands: Ben/T-Mobile (US$ 0.080)

  • Netherlands: Dutchtone/Orange (US$ 0.080)

  • Netherlands: KPN Mobile (US$ 0.080)

  • Poland: PTK Centertel (US$ 0.060)

  • Portugal Optimus (US$ 0.080)

  • Spain: Airtel Vodafone (US$ 0.080)

  • Spain: Amena (US$ 0.080)

  • Spain: Telefonica (US$ 0.080)

  • Spain: Xsfera Moviles (US$ 0.080)

  • Sweden: Telia (US$ 0.080)

  • Sweden: Comviq Tele2 (US$ 0.080)

  • Sweden: Vodafone (US$ 0.080)

  • Sweden: H3G (US$ 0.080)

  • Turkey: Turkcell (US$ 0.080)

  • UAE: ETISALAT (US$ 0.070)

  • UK: Vodafone (US$ 0.070)

  • UK: T-Mobile (US$ 0.070)

  • UK: Orange (US$ 0.070)

  • UK: O2 (US$ 0.070)

For each sms sent, the charge will be calculated on the profile tarif based of the Client, in addition of the Rate of Interconnection.
